    China Re-Closes Movie Theaters After One Weekend


    After re-opening for one weekend, China has ordered all movie theaters to close their doors again, due to an increase of imported coronavirus cases. Last week, industry analysts reported that China could reopen movie theaters in late April or early May. Surprisingly, China then opened theaters just a few days later, to very low crowds. In order to boost audience numbers, they planned to rerelease hits like Avengers and Avatar.

    According to Deadline, the national film bureau in China ordered all theaters to close again today. There's no mention of when they might open once again. They initially opened 500 theaters this past weekend, and Shanghai planned to re-open 205 more on Saturday. This decision comes after 53 new coronavirus cases were reported yesterday as coming from overseas.

    The country will likely take actions to limit foreigners from coming into China for the time being. They have had 81,340 confirmed cases, and have seen a decline in new cases reported daily. Other countries like the United States are yet to hit the peak of the pandemic, with cases multiplying every day.

    The news of theaters opening again brought hope and optimism to both China and the world. This quick reversal means it will likely be at least a few more weeks until they can open up again. U.S. movie theaters have reportedly gotten financial support from the Senate in order to weather the temporary closures. They will possibly be free to attend when they first reopen in the future.
